Transaction 38684539874df1da1eeb1064447ab481f0d2972bb8914e189e69e28caace6454

2 Input
2 Outputs
  • 38684539874df1da1eeb1064447ab481f0d2972bb8914e189e69e28caace6454:0
  • value  15750000
    address  1CX5ry3w7vwpTt1bfhvuygWojK267ikfFa
  • 38684539874df1da1eeb1064447ab481f0d2972bb8914e189e69e28caace6454:1
  • value  77881
    address  19Z3arFEdzaKY9Q5MW1HbbMNWyWKwDaRqM